Grant Overview

In the face of escalating climate-related threats, communities are increasingly recognizing the necessity for resilient infrastructure. This funding opportunity emphasizes the improvement of municipal infrastructure to withstand extreme weather events, particularly in vulnerable coastal towns. Recent policy changes and heightened awareness around climate adaptation are driving this funding, with a focus on building systems capable of addressing flooding, storm surges, and pollution.

Prioritization within this initiative is notably shaped by the increasing frequency of natural disasters, as evidenced by recent data indicating a rise in flooding incidents along coastlines. Local governments that demonstrate proactive measures in enhancing climate resilience are likely to position themselves favorably when applying for these funds. Infrastructure upgrades could include the installation of green roofs, permeable pavements, and systems for managing stormwater more effectively, thereby reducing pollution while enhancing community safety.

As municipalities prepare grant submissions, they must demonstrate capacity requirements that align with the funding expectations. This encompasses not just physical infrastructure but also skilled personnel capable of executing and monitoring adaptation strategies. For example, a city may need to invest in engineers familiar with sustainable design or collaborate with universities that specialize in climate research. Applications that fail to meet these capacity requirements might find themselves at a disadvantage in the competitive funding landscape.

However, potential applicants should be aware that there are various fit assessment criteria that will shape funding decisions. Projects that include integrative community engagement componentssuch as workshops to educate residents on climate adaptation practiceswill have a distinct edge. Moreover, proposals that leverage existing data to inform their decisions, provide evidence of previous successes, or build on regional climate action plans are more likely to be favorably reviewed.

In summary, the emphasis on climate resilience infrastructure funding reflects a broader shift towards proactive measures in climate adaptation. Communities that can articulate a comprehensive plan for improvement, ensuring that they quantify their risks and outline clear outcomes, will be better positioned to utilize these resources effectively. As funding streams grow increasingly competitive, the ability to present a coherent, data-driven narrative about climate resilience will be essential for success.
